Amazon Announces Layoffs, Shifts Focus to AI Investment
In a move reflecting the shifting priorities of the tech giant, Amazon announced on October 28, 2025, that it would be laying off roughly 14,000 corporate workers. This decision comes as the company aims to become leaner, less bureaucratic, and more focused on emerging technologies, particularly generative AI.
